Latest Patents

Sathyanarayana holds a patent for a method titled "Treatment Of Phosphate-Containing Wastewater." This method involves several steps, including the removal of fluoride from the wastewater, recovering phosphate compounds by maintaining supersaturation conditions, and polishing the wastewater. An optional silica removal step can also be performed after fluoride removal and before phosphate recovery.
